Li Chunjun is the crown prince of the Sword Empire and one of the best elite geniuses in the Cangmang Continent. He is also one of the most trustworthy friends of Zhou Yuan.

Appearance[]

A young man in ash-colored robes. However, white cloth has been wrapped around his eyes.

On his back was a plain-looking black sword that had no tip. A faint but astonishing sword qi spread from it. Wherever he passes, the rocks on the ground would silently split apart, the interior of the cut pieces smooth as a mirror.

Personality[]

Li Chunjun is extremely dedicated to swordsmanship. Therefore, he doesn't experience much social interaction with others besides battling with them or necessary communication as he spends all his time to train. That's why Chunjun is very straightforward in his speech and manner, which some people feel comfortable with like Zhou Yuan because Li Chunjun is very honest while some think he is arrogant or disrespectful. He is the type to remember the debt he owes, and when the opportunity arises, he would repay it immediately.

Due to his humility, when someone in his generation surpasses him like Zhou Yuan, Li Chunjun believes that it's because he has trained not enough even though his training regime already frightens others. He sets them as his goal to beat them one day, honing his sword skills. Moreover, he could judge what the best situation should be and whom to support; for example, he helps open a path for Zhou Yuan to reach the top of the waterfall with Wu Huang in the final battle of Saint Relic Domain because he thinks that Zhou Yuan is the one who could challenge Wu Huang.

Li Chunjun is quite directionally challenged.

History[]

The rumor says that Li Chunjun blinded both his eyes for the sake of his sword cultivation. It could easily say that he was one of the best amongst the younger generation in the Cangmang Continent. In fact, he was not inferior even when matched up against the likes of Wu Huang.
